Organoleptic Properties

Odor Type: Coumarinic
sweet, caramellic, coumarinic, nutty
Odor strength medium
Substantivity 400 hour(s) at 20.00 %
Luebke, William tgsc, (1986) At 100.00 %. sweet caramel coumarin nutty
TONKA BEAN RES gives a very nice natural effect in the fern, amber and oriental notes. Coumarin is responsible of the pleasant odor of the beans, which led the perfume industry to label these extracts in the “Gourmand” family. Warm and sweet notes reminiscent of caramel, almond and vanilla

Oral/Parenteral Toxicity:
oral-rat LD50 1380 mg/kg
Food and Cosmetics Toxicology. Vol. 12, Pg. 1005, 1974.

Dermal Toxicity:
skin-rabbit LD50 1260 mg/kg
Food and Cosmetics Toxicology. Vol. 12, Pg. 1005, 1974.
